It's still trading 4.5 years of a high ceiling SP for 2.5 years of a talented but replacement level RF. Sure, Mazara is also high ceiling, but he has had far more opportunities to prove himself than Lopez. Simply due to the years of control, I wouldn't want to pull the trigger on that deal but I can at least understand why some would.- PTC Thursday July 25th at 7:10 PM CDT Minnesota at Chicago

I know I'm a broken record with Fry but IMO, his trade value should be very close to Bummer's. LHP, long-term control, high strikeout rate, sound mechanics, 5 pitches, etc. The only problem is the walk rate, but it's correctable and he has been back to 2018 Fry for about a month now. What I'm saying is that I would 100% not be ok with trading him for Nomar Mazara.- Eloy going on IL
